expected. The ECM monitors the feedback signal
values from the Exhaust Back Pressure (EBP) sensor
and compares those values to the expected values.
If a fault is detected the test will end, engine operation
will return to normal, and a DTC will be set.
If there are no faults, the test will be completed and
engine operation will return to normal.

2. Select Diagnostics from the menu bar.
3. Select Key-On Engine-Running Tests from the
drop down menu.
NOTE: When using the EST to do KOEO or KOER
diagnostic tests, Standard test is always selected
and run first. If the ignition switch is not cycled, the
Standard test does not have to be run again.
4. From KOER Diagnostics menu,
Management and Run to start the test.
5. Correct problem causing active DTCs.
6. Clear DTCs.
